The Evolution of Yamaha Carburetors:
Yamaha has consistently improved and refined its carburetor designs over the years. Starting with traditional slide-type carburetors, they gradually transitioned to flat-slide and later to constant-velocity (CV) carburetors. Each design brought advancements in fuel atomization, throttle response, and overall engine performance.
Slide-Type Carburetors:
Slide-type carburetors were widely used in earlier Yamaha motorcycles. These carburetors feature a throttle slide that controls the airflow through the main bore. Yamaha implemented various modifications, such as the use of multiple jets, to enhance fuel delivery at different engine speeds.
Flat-Slide Carburetors:
To further optimize fuel-air mixture delivery, Yamaha introduced flat-slide carburetors in some of their high-performance models. The flat-slide design reduces turbulence and improves throttle response, allowing for precise control of fuel flow. This innovation resulted in increased engine power and smoother acceleration.
Constant-Velocity (CV) Carburetors:
In recent years, Yamaha has adopted constant-velocity carburetors in many of their motorcycles. These carburetors utilize a vacuum-operated slide to maintain a consistent velocity of airflow, resulting in improved fuel efficiency and better throttle response across a wide range of engine speeds. CV carburetors are also less prone to throttle "flat spots," ensuring a smoother riding experience.
Advantages of Yamaha Carburetors:
a) Fuel Efficiency: Yamaha carburetors are designed to deliver an optimal fuel-air mixture, maximizing fuel efficiency without sacrificing performance. This makes Yamaha motorcycles economical and cost-effective for riders in the long run.
b) Easy Maintenance: Carburetors require periodic cleaning and adjustments to ensure optimal performance. Yamaha carburetors are known for their user-friendly design, making maintenance tasks relatively simple for riders or mechanics. Proper maintenance guarantees consistent engine performance.
c) Tuning Flexibility: Yamaha carburetors offer a wide range of tuning options, allowing riders to modify their motorcycle's performance characteristics according to their preferences. With the right adjustments, riders can achieve improved power delivery, throttle response, and overall engine performance.
d) Durability: Yamaha carburetors are built to withstand the rigorous demands of motorcycle riding. With proper care and maintenance, they can provide years of reliable service.
